Body types are as different as apples and oranges (or apples and pears) due to gender, genetics, and lifestyle choices. While you can actively influence some of these factors, many are completely out of your control. For example, pregnancy and dramatic weight fluctuations can leave changes that won’t respond to diet and exercise alone. In some cases, plastic surgery may be the answer to creating a more appealing and balanced physique. Plastic surgery does not help you lose weight, but a capable surgeon can remove excess tissue, tighten loose areas, and ultimately influence where you gain weight in the future.
Options for body contouring range from non-invasive fat removal with no downtime or discomfort (Zeltiq’s CoolSculpt™) to body lift procedures that require more extensive surgeries and recovery. We base decisions on your history of weight fluctuations, skin quality, fat distribution, muscle laxity, medical risk, and commitment to making healthy choices in the future to maintain results.
Because there may be many options available, a consultation with physical exam is essential prior to our making appropriate recommendations. CoolSculpt™ by Zeltiq
Coolsculpt™ technology by Zeltiq is a tremendous breakthrough using a non-invasive, effective, reliable, and FDA-approved method of fat removal. Envision a powerful vacuum cleaner attachment about the size of your hand placed against the unwanted bulge that sucks up the skin and fat against cooling plates. While the skin is protected, the fat is cooled for one hour, to the point that ice crystals will form within the lipids of the fat cells. This leads to a form of cell death called apoptosis. Your inflammatory cells will then clear approximately 20% of the fat from the treated area at two months, and this may continue for several more months. You can repeat the procedure in the same area as early as one month for an additive effect.
The best candidates for Coolsculpt are those with subcutaneous fat in the trunk area (think tummy, back, love-handle, muffin-top), good elasticity to the skin, and who are at normal body weight or mildly overweight. Because there is no surgery, no drugs, and no downtime this is a fantastic alternative for many patients. You can multi-task during your treatments by reading, talking on your phone, or even getting your Botox! You can even go straight to the gym once you are done since there are no limitations on your post-treatment activities and very minimal discomfort.
Expect to be bruised and swollen for several days, with mild tenderness and numbness. You will then experience some mild tingling or itching in the area for a few additional days. The area may stay slightly numb for the next 1-2 months.
We currently have three hand-pieces (the new jumbo that treats twice the area of the smaller ones was just released in late October 2010), and at this time legs are really not recommended with the current technology.
